# Important notes on the code # Important notes on the code
**You can generate an internal overview with doxygen. For this, use `make doc-doxygen` and you'll find an internal overview of all functions and symbols in `docs/internal/html`.**
# Comments
- Comment system is held similar to JavaDoc
- Use `@param` to describe all input parameters
- Documentation comments should start with a double star (`/**`)
- Append `()` to function names and prepend variables with `#` to properly reference them in the docs
- Add comments to all functions and methods
- Markdown inside the comments is allowed and also desired
- Add the comments to the prototype. Doxygen will merge the protoype and implementation documentation anyways.
Except for **static** methods, add the documentation header to the implementation and *not to the prototype*.
- Member documentation should happen with `/**<` and should span to the right side of the member
